Peterson out due to quad cramping, but KU rolls
Darryn Peterson missed Tuesday's game against Towson after experiencing cramping in his quad, but No. 17 Kansas cruised to a 73-49 win.
Louisville's Brown (back) sidelined in loss to Vols
Louisville star freshman Mikel Brown Jr. did not play Tuesday night against Tennessee because of a lower back injury.
Brown, USC agree to cancel game after shooting
The USC and Brown men's basketball teams have mutually agreed to cancel their nonconference game that was scheduled to be played Sunday in Los Angeles.
Arizona still No. 1; Duke, Iowa St. get votes
No. 1 Arizona and No. 2 Michigan remained locked in place atop the Associated Press men's college basketball poll, with No. 3 Duke and No. 4 Iowa State getting first-place votes this week.
Source: U-M launches athletic department query
The University of Michigan has commissioned an investigation into its athletic department, centering on how numerous scandals have both occurred and been handled in recent years, a source told ESPN.
MSU's Izzo gets raise, is highest-paid in Big Ten
Michigan State's Tom Izzo is getting a $1 million raise in his five-year contract that automatically renews annually, a boost that makes him the highest-paid coach in the Big Ten with a salary of about $7.2 million.
